Output 3db388696a806d283d09e05c85a42633ac67dad84d4865ad5c9e4a18110d3984:1

value
988268589
script pubkey
OP_0 OP_PUSHBYTES_20 d8ca949c9c5cdedccd4f449e8b22ca166c0e8523
address
tb1qmr9ff8yutn0den20gj0gkgk2zekqapfrevcdqu
transaction
3db388696a806d283d09e05c85a42633ac67dad84d4865ad5c9e4a18110d3984